Output 99d964d6336ef0961deafaf589712f00cc194963ee6b3ee055c2deae49b8815c:15

value
571831515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6e6c1e78a0131d920fc00984d7c81d6d5f4ae95 OP_EQUAL
address
MUx45rnRWUsBy1FTxmax5Enb8puZTvhf6L
transaction
99d964d6336ef0961deafaf589712f00cc194963ee6b3ee055c2deae49b8815c
spent
true